Religion: C. E. F.

Protestant missionaries followed and profited spiritually by the course of British Empire. Last week in Italy's Ethiopia, to some 75 Protestant men and women of God came tardy realization that not they but Roman Catholics will follow the course of Italian Empire. For some weeks, Protestant missionaries leaving Ethiopia have found it impossible to reenter. Last week occurred the first expulsions of missionaries, three U. S. and seven British.
